Agilent HP 4287A 1 MHz - 3 GHz RF LCR Meter w/ Opt 010 - CALIBRATED!
This is an Agilent / HP 4287A 1 MHz to 3 GHz RF LCR Meter with Option 010 (Hard Disk Drive Storage) and a fresh calibration. The 4287A RF LCR meter offers accurate, reliable and fast measurements from 1 MHz to 3 GHz to improve quality and throughput of electronic component testing in production lines. The 4287A employs the direct-current voltage-measurement technique, as opposed to the reflection-measurement technique, which yields accurate measurements over a wide impedance range. Features: Frequency 1 MHz to 3 GHz, with 100 kHz steps Measurement Range Wide impedance measurement range from 200 m ohm to 3 k ohm Basic Accuracy 1% basic accuracy More Features Superior measurement repeatability at low test signal level High-speed measurements: 9 ms
